Start to finish they handled the baiting, rigging, netting and bleeding of the fish professionally. Once the Kings were in the boat, they were dispatched and bled in a separate tub that had fresh water running through. Once the water was clear they were put in saline ice water to chill below 32 degrees until we docked, and then transported straight to the fillet hand that met us at the boat. Once filleted, our fish was taken about 50 feet to J-Docks for vacuum and packing for flight ready transport. We had a layaway with J-Dock and added fish we caught each day. Picked up our fish the morning of the last day, frozen and packaged for flight. Max fisherman on the F/V Florette C. is six and everyone caught their limits of Kings each day we went out. Two of us caught really nice Ivory King Salmon, rare with even higher omegas. All of the Kings we caught were considered feeder kings, and found in salt water.
